Indian Classical Music Professor Guarang Doshi
Screenshot

Gaurang Doshi is a recipient of the 2025 North Carolina Heritage Award, presented by the North Carolina Arts Council, the highest honor given to a traditional artist in the state. Doshi teaches Indian classical music at UNCG, the only university in the state that offers Indian classical music.
